**Position Summary and Purpose**:

- **Blueprint Analysis**: Study blueprints, drawings, and engineering information to determine production methods.
- **Machine Operation**: Set up and operate CNC Lathes as needed, ensuring they meet specifications. Setting tolerance levels and cutting speeds.
- **Quality Inspection**: Perform inspections on manufactured parts to maintain quality standards.
- **Data Entry**: Enter production data into the data collection system.
- **Cleanliness**: Maintain a clean working area at all times.
- **Safety**: Must follow all safety protocols. Safety boots and safety glasses at all times.

**Requirements**:
We're looking for A CNC Lathe Machinist who will meet the following requirements:

- **Experience**: Minimum of 3 years' of dedicated CNC Lathe set-up and operating experience.
- **Precision Instruments**: Competency with micrometers, calipers, indicators, and other inspection gauges.
- **Blueprint Reading**: Proficiency in reading blueprints.
- **Skills**: Highly motivated, detail-oriented, service-oriented, with str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
- **Physical Stamina**: Able to work 8-10 hours a day while standing.
- **Education**: High school diploma or GED. Basic math, geometry, and trigonometry skills

**The Company**:
Established in 1953, Moeller Precision Tool stands as the foremost global manufacturer of precision tooling for the metal forming and stamping industry. Boasting an extensive worldwide distribution network, our products cater to diverse sectors including appliances, automotive, pharmaceuticals, and more. As a family-owned and operated enterprise, we take pride in our two facilities in the United States and four international sites located in Canada, Mexico, Italy, and the UK.

Our relentless growth and global prominence are propelled by state-of-the-art technology and a highly skilled workforce. At Moeller, we place a premium on the continuous development and progression of our team members, fostering internal promotions across all six manufacturing sites.
